I almost always get my deliveries in two days unless, prior to ordering, it actually says under the delivery options that, though Prime, it gives a longer delivery date. The only time I ever had an issue was last year when I ordered some red Christmas bows. They were Prime yet we're not delivered in two days. When I checked later, the expected ship date had changed. I can't remember the exact sequence of events, but I denied up calling Amazon to complain b/c at some point, I realized I wasn't going to even get them in time for Christmas and I was using them for outdoor decor-this was 2-3 weeks prior to Christmas. I was told the same thing as jelly toast, that the 2-day guarantee is for when it actually leaves the warehouse, not from the day it was ordered. However, the customer service rep was very helpful/understanding - not only canceled my order but also gave me a $25 credit for my troubles. That, however, is the only time I did not receive an order in two days. Just recently, I ordered something late on Friday and it was delivered on Sunday. As far as pricing, I definitely check prices b/c sometimes the Prime prices are more.
